Hello, I have had this printer approximately 2 years and it has been great, its a little worker! Over the last couple of weeks the driver seemed to have a funny on my laptop and so I uninstalled it and installed it (it stopped printing in colour and there was no option to change it back to colour until I deleted every single bit of it from my laptop and reinstalled from windows printer wizard)

Now I can thankfully print in colour again (I was very stressed as I use this for my business) but now it saying there is an error and I cannot print A4 borderless. It says there is a conflict and I have to amend either the size of paper or change to borderless off. I have ALWAYS been able to print to A4 card borderless as I print invitations for my business. So not sure why all of sudden I am no longer able to print borderless. I have changed each paper setting to photo paper and nothing makes a difference. 

As I said I have had this printer for about 2 years ands it a great machine and I use HP instant ink which is also fantastic for my business but I really need to print borderless!! 

I have read many posts on here and the replies always seem to be robotic (as in not reading my full post and actually seeing that I could do this before and it has suddenly stopped doing it after I had to fix the printing colour problem that is also happening a lot!) 

I really need this fixing for my business asap please. I really don't want to have to go through the hassle of deleting the driver again as I am worried the colour option will disappear again (I tried to download it from here but it still didn't work)

The issue you are facing is likely :

  • Corrupted driver installation - and No, I won't tell you to remove and install the software, though, at some point down the road, it might be necessary.  NOTE:  If reinstallation does become necessary, you will want to remove every scrap of the printer software before (re)installing it.  This is not the normal "uninstall", but it is not difficult.  I will not post it here; this message is already too long.
  • An ill-matched settings combination that is a result of missing settings, settings chosen in the wrong order (that can actually be a thing), or settings that would work if they were just the "preferred" setup.

 

In general, most of what you can do about the settings is controlled in the software you use to set up and present the job to the printer.

 

A couple of places to check:

 

The Specifications do not show A4 as a supported size for "borderless" printing - not on plain paper and not on photo paper.  Discussing whether the printer has been doing this is pointless, though it does mean that anything I suggest cannot be verified with the documentation.  I might have missed something, after all.

 

In general, the Specifications include what the printer can do:

  • Plain Paper in size A4 is supported (though not indicated for borderless)
  • Photo Paper is not supported in size A4 (borderless or otherwise)
  • Card Paper - Index is supported in A4 (though no indication whether borderless is supported on this Media type)

 

There is indication that the Printer supports Custom Sizes, though, I cannot verify that this is the case.  I am not aware that using a Custom Size form has any impact on borderless printing.

Set the Preferences - Windows

 

  1. The following assumes the Full Feature Software has been installed.
  2. Check / enable the printer as the “Default Printer”
  3. Select and adjust settings in each category for the Media (kind of paper), source (tray), and paper size.

 

Control Panel > icon view > Devices and Printers > Right-Click on your printer > Set as Default

 

Control Panel > icon view > Devices and Printers > Right-Click on your printer > Printing Preferences >

Tab Printing Shortcuts > Click / Highlight preferred shortcut > Click Apply > Click OK to exit

 

If the printer software supports the feature, change the settings as desired, then use “Save as” to create a Custom Shortcut.

 

OR

Windows key + S (search for) Printers and Scanners

Left-Click on (your) Printer > Manage >

Printing Preferences

Select a shortcut and / or set “preferred settings” for paper, source (tray), other settings

Optional (if / as available): Save As > enter a name for your custom shortcut

Click OK to save the preferences

Assuming the ability to print A4 borderless is there, I would guess that the issue might be one of the printer software not reading the settings correctly, the settings not being configured completely, or the installation of the software needs to be removed and reloaded.

 

If you did indeed completely remove all the printer software, including any leftover bits in Devices and Printers and the software that hides in the user account, then reinstalling again will not likely fix the problem.

 

That leaves that the configuration may not be set - since the A4 is not listed in the Specifications as supporting borderless, perhaps you had a custom shortcut created for this setting that included the A4 as a custom paper size for borderless printing.  Ordinarily, custom shortcuts might survive reloading the software - not always and not when all traces of the previous installation of that software were removed prior to reinstalling the printer software.
